CHOOSING THE RIGHT TOOLS FOR EFFECTIVE AUTOMATION TESTING SOLUTIONS

Choosing the Right Tools for Effective Automation Testing Solutions

Choosing the Right Tools for Effective Automation Testing Solutions

Blog Article

From Manual to Automated Testing: A Comprehensive Guide to Transitioning Smoothly and Effectively



In the realm of software testing, the shift from manual to automated processes has actually come to be a significantly essential change for companies looking for to boost performance and precision in their testing methods. As innovation remains to advancement, the requirement for seamless and effective automated testing methods has actually never ever been a lot more important. The journey from handbook to automated testing is not without its difficulties, but when approached tactically and with a clear plan in mind, the advantages can be considerable - automation testing. In this extensive overview, we will check out vital steps and factors to consider essential for a successful shift, from the initial option of tools to the integration of automation into existing operations. Keep tuned to uncover the understandings that will aid lead the way for a smoother and a lot more efficient testing procedure.


Advantages of Automated Testing



Automated screening offers many advantages, improving performance and accuracy in software program development procedures. One key benefit is the substantial reduction in testing time. Automated examinations can be run at the same time on numerous tools and operating systems, significantly quickening the testing stage contrasted to manual testing. This raised efficiency enables for faster responses on the quality of the software application, making it possible for developers to determine and attend to concerns promptly.


In addition, automated screening ensures a greater degree of accuracy in discovering problems. Consistency in testing is also improved, as automated examinations implement the exact same steps specifically each time they are run.


Picking the Right Devices



automation testingautomation testing
When transitioning to automated testing, the trick to success exists in very carefully selecting the appropriate tools for the job. Choosing the right tools is essential as they develop the structure of your automated testing framework. When selecting the devices that best fit your demands., there are various variables to take into consideration.


First of all, examine your demands and objectives. Comprehend the scope of your project, the technologies included, and the skill set of your team. This analysis will aid you determine the attributes and abilities you require in your testing devices.


Secondly, consider the compatibility of the devices with your existing procedures and systems. Seamless combination with your current software program growth lifecycle is vital to guarantee a smooth transition to automation.


Furthermore, review the scalability and flexibility of the devices. As your testing needs progress, the devices ought to have the ability to adapt and fit adjustments efficiently.


Lastly, consider the assistance and community around the tools. Durable support and an energetic individual area can offer beneficial resources and help when executing automated screening. By very carefully considering these elements, you can select the right devices that line up with your needs and set the stage for a successful transition to automated testing.




Creating Efficient Examination Scripts



automation testingautomation testing
To make sure the effective implementation of selected testing devices, the creation of effective examination manuscripts plays a critical function in validating the capability and performance of automated procedures. Composing reliable examination scripts involves careful planning, clear documentation, and adherence to finest methods. Test scripts must be succinct, focused, and made to cover different examination scenarios comprehensively.


When crafting test manuscripts, it is vital to think about the specific demands of the software being examined and make sure that the scripts attend to all crucial capabilities. Descriptive and clear calling conventions for test manuscripts and test cases can boost readability and maintainability. Furthermore, integrating mistake handling devices within the examination scripts can help in recognizing and attending to concerns immediately.


In addition, organizing examination manuscripts into modular elements can improve reusability and scalability, reducing redundancy and boosting effectiveness in test script maintenance. Regular testimonials and updates to evaluate manuscripts are vital to equal progressing software requirements and performances. By adhering to these principles, testers can produce reliable her comment is here and durable test manuscripts that add considerably to the success of automated screening processes.


Integrating Automation Into Workflows



Efficient integration of automation devices right into existing operations enhances processes and enhances efficiency within software application advancement cycles. When including automation right into workflows, it is important to determine repeated tasks that can additional info be automated to save time and minimize human error. By seamlessly incorporating automated testing tools like Selenium or Appium right into the software program advancement lifecycle, teams can accomplish faster comments on code adjustments, causing quicker insect detection and resolution. This integration enables for continuous testing throughout the advancement procedure, making sure that any concerns are identified at an early stage, leading to greater software application top quality. Additionally, automation can be made use of to trigger tests instantly after each code commit, providing instant validation and freeing up testers to concentrate on more complicated circumstances. Correct integration of automation devices requires collaboration in between growth, screening, and procedures groups to establish a unified workflow that enhances performance and effectiveness in delivering high-grade software.


Guaranteeing a Smooth Shift



Successfully transitioning to automated testing involves precise preparation and mindful implementation to optimize and minimize interruptions effectiveness in the software application development procedure - automation testing. To make sure a smooth shift, it is vital to start by performing an extensive assessment of the present testing procedures and recognizing locations where automation can bring the most substantial benefits. Involving with all stakeholders at an early stage while doing so, including developers, testers, and job managers, is critical for amassing assistance and buy-in for the automation initiative


Communication is crucial during this transition stage. Clear communication of visit this web-site the objectives, advantages, and assumptions of automated screening assists to handle any type of resistance or worries that may develop. Furthermore, supplying appropriate training and resources for staff member to upskill in automation devices and strategies is essential for making certain an effective shift.


automation testingautomation testing
Regular tracking and analysis of the automated testing procedures are essential to identify any type of traffic jams or problems without delay. By continuously refining and enhancing the automated screening operations, teams can maintain a high level of efficiency and efficiency in their software advancement lifecycle.


Verdict



In verdict, transitioning from handbook to automated testing supplies numerous advantages, including enhanced performance and reliability. By picking the suitable tools, composing efficient examination manuscripts, and incorporating automation effortlessly right into operations, companies can make certain a effective and smooth change. It is necessary to embrace automation as a valuable asset in software program testing processes to improve overall quality and productivity.


In the world of software program screening, the change from handbook to automated processes has come to be a significantly essential change for companies seeking to enhance performance and precision in their testing practices. Automated examinations can be run all at once on numerous gadgets and operating systems, significantly speeding up the testing stage compared to manual screening. Consistency in testing is additionally enhanced, as automated tests execute the very same steps precisely each time they are run.To make certain the effective implementation of picked screening tools, the creation of efficient test manuscripts plays an important role in confirming the performance and performance of automated procedures - automation testing. By complying with these concepts, testers can produce robust and reliable examination scripts that add considerably to the success of automated testing procedures

Report this page